Lawrence Tech is a student-centered, comprehensive, teaching university with focused, technologically oriented professional programs.  As a student-centered university, we have developed educational goals in five critical areas and a detailed plan and process for assessing educational outcomes of LTU students in these key areas. A University Assessment Committee comprised of faculty representatives from each academic department, the Provost, Associate Provost, and Director of Institutional Research have the primary responsibility of assessing student educational outcomes.
